Being wedged between the Tasman Sea and the Illawarra escarpment, Wollongong roofs cope with salt-carrying nor'easters on one side and heavy orographic downpours rolling off the mountain on the other. Any roofer working here regularly knows it well. Sitting near the coast, Wollongong roofs pick up enough airborne salt that we always check steel components closely and recommend corrosion-resistant replacements. A full installation covers structural checks and any frame preparation, sarking and insulation layers, battens set to the profile's exact spacing, the roof covering itself (Colorbond steel or tiles, per your choice and the home's style), all flashings, valleys, capping and penetration seals, plus gutters and downpipes sized for Wollongong's rainfall. We manage the sequence end to end, and everything is installed to manufacturer specification — which is what keeps warranties valid.
For Wollongong installations we typically specify standard Colorbond steel or quality concrete/terracotta tile — both excellent this far from heavy salt — with the design attention going to drainage capacity, insulation performance and hail resilience.
